Based on a one woman performative concert featuring feminine heroes. Each episode of the podcast is a new opportunity to develop each character separately through a combination of exchanges with the contributors, biographical research and the poetics of story-telling, resulting in a collection of sonic, intimate confessions.

Known as the wife of...Ulysses, her name is synonmous with marital fidelity. But she was so much more and it was so surprisingly progressive for a white, blind man to have written a story dating back to antiquity about a woman that could rule a country on her own, outwit all of her suitors and be a single mom. In essence, this woman was a badass.
